Second Half
The second half exploded with action right from the whistle. Millonarios finally broke the deadlock in the 55th minute. A beautiful cross from Daniel Ruiz found Jader Valencia, who headed the ball past Chaux, sending the Millonarios fans into a frenzy. The stadium erupted with cheers as Millonarios took the lead. However, Once Caldas responded quickly. In the 68th minute, a penalty was awarded after a foul in the box. Dayro Moreno stepped up and calmly slotted the ball into the net, leveling the score. The tension in the stadium was palpable as both teams pushed for the winning goal. In the 75th minute, Millonarios' substitute, Luis Carlos Ruiz, made an immediate impact, scoring a brilliant goal from outside the box. His stunning strike put Millonarios back in the lead. But Once Caldas refused to give up. In the 88th minute, a corner kick found its way to Jorge Cardona, who headed home, making it 2-2. The late equalizer silenced the Millonarios fans and ignited the hopes of the Once Caldas supporters. The final minutes were filled with frantic attacks and desperate defending, but neither team could find the decisive goal. The match ended in a thrilling 2-2 draw, a result that reflected the competitiveness and intensity of the game. Player Performances
Some players really stood out during this match. For Millonarios, Daniel Ruiz was a constant threat, providing the assist for the first goal and creating numerous chances. Jader Valencia also had a solid performance, scoring the opening goal and working tirelessly upfront. Luis Carlos Ruiz's stunning goal off the bench earned him high praise. On the Once Caldas side, Éder Chaux was exceptional in goal, making several crucial saves to keep his team in the game. Dayro Moreno showed his experience and composure by converting the penalty. Jorge Cardona's late equalizer made him a hero for the Once Caldas fans.
Tactical Analysis
Millonarios' strategy focused on maintaining possession and attacking through the wings. Their full-backs pushed high up the pitch, providing width and support to the wingers. The midfield duo of Juan Carlos Pereira and Stiven Vega controlled the tempo of the game and broke up opposition attacks. However, their defense was vulnerable at times, particularly against counter-attacks. Once Caldas adopted a more conservative approach, prioritizing a solid defensive structure and looking to exploit Millonarios' defensive weaknesses on the break. Their wingers, Marcelino Carreazo and David Lemos, were a constant threat with their pace and dribbling skills. The midfield battle was crucial, with Alejandro GarcĂa and Juan David RodrĂguez working hard to win back possession and disrupt Millonarios' flow. The tactical approaches of both teams contributed to the thrilling and unpredictable nature of the match.
